How about a look inside the historic Convocation Center? This multi-purpose arena has been a cornerstone of the University of Texas at San Antonio since 1975. The Convocation Center is home to the UTSA Roadrunners men’s and women’s basketball and volleyball teams.

Known affectionately as “The Convo” and the “Bird Cage”, this arena has a seating capacity of 4,080. It is more than just a sports venue. The Convocation Center has hosted numerous events. These events include high school playoff games, university convocation ceremonies, concerts, speeches, and career fairs. It even served as the venue for UTSA Commencement ceremonies.

Imagine the roar of the crowd during the Southland Conference men’s basketball tournament. The Convocation Center hosted it in 1992 and 2004. Think of the echoes of legendary bands like AC/DC and Black Sabbath. They once played right here.

The Convocation Center saw 2021 NCAA Women’s Basketball First and Second Round Games. It has also hosted several conference basketball and volleyball tournaments.

The Convocation Center features a Robins Biocushion maple floor. It also boasts Hussey retractable seating. Two auxiliary courts offer additional space. A 10′ x 19′ 10mm LED videoboard enhances the fan experience. Two Daktronics LED end-wall scoreboards keep everyone updated. A center-hung scoreboard displays all the action. Eight collapsible goals complete the setup.

UTSA’s athletic journey began in 1981 with its first men’s basketball team. The Roadrunners steadily climbed conferences. They reached Conference USA in 2013-14. The team made four NCAA Tournament appearances. They also appeared in one CIT tourney.

Derrick Gervin and Devin Brown once graced this court. Both players even reached the NBA. Their numbers hang from the rafters.

The Convocation Center atmosphere is unique. The lower bowl seating puts fans close to the action. The student section adds energy to the game. Banners commemorate tournament appearances. Trophy cases chronicle UTSA’s athletic history.

The Convocation Center is located in the heart of UTSA’s Main Campus. Fans can park for free on game days in designated lots.

Although some say it is cavernous, the Convocation Center holds a special place in the hearts of Roadrunner Nation. It has witnessed countless games, concerts, and celebrations. The Convocation Center continues to be a vibrant hub for the university and its community.
